The Hypertension Score in 62097, Worden, Illinois is 54 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

88.69 percent of the population in 62097 drive to work alone. 0.35 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 50.98 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 8.10 percent of the residents in 62097 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.57 members with about 2.47 cars available per household.

An estimate of 96.63 percent of the residents in 62097 has some form of health insurance. 23.19 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 88.03 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 62097 would have to travel an average of 7.05 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Community Hospital Of Staunton .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 62097, Worden, Illinois.

Hypertension, commonly known as high blood pressure, is a medical condition where the force of the blood against the artery walls is consistently too high. It can lead to serious health issues such as heart disease, stroke, and kidney problems if not properly managed. For individuals with Hypertension, regular medical check-ups and access to healthcare providers are essential for monitoring and controlling their condition.
